Responsibilities

The Social Worker applies principles of Social Work and other behavioral health practices to provide patients and families with assessment, interventions, support, advocacy, and case management as a primary provider and/or as ancillary support to the primary medical provider. In all departments the Social Worker practices as a member of a multi‑disciplinary team, providing clinical intervention and support to patients and families. The Social Worker assesses, develops treatment plans, and intervenes to address the needs identified in the assessment and by the team. Utilizing knowledge of culture, age, and developmental stages, the Social Worker develops treatment plans and provides interventions, either as an independent practitioner or as a member of a clinical team. The Social Worker may also provide support and debriefing to SWHS staff following traumatic events.
